Point72 Middle East FZE's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2023, Point72 Middle East FZE held 2,193 positions worth $3.6B, up 23% from $2.93B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Point72 Middle East FZE deployed $559M of net new capital in Q2 2023, opening 624 new positions and adding to 517 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was AbbVie: 129,855 shares worth $17.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.7% of assets, down from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Honeywell, an estimated $21.6M trimmed.
